The North Georgia Zoo in Cleveland, Georgia offers up a unique experience for animal lovers to interact with a ton of unusual and unique species.
While we can go on and on about how cool this Georgia zoo is and how many animals are here living their best lives, there is one experience at this zoo that you just have to consider.
The Winter Wolf Experience is one of the most unforgettable animal encounters you’ll have, giving you an up-close-and-personal experience with stunning arctic wolves.
You can participate in a few different wolf experiences—the Winter Wolf Experience which allows you to meet one to two wolves, plus assist with training and learn all about these beautiful friends.
You can also try the Young Wolf Experience, which allows for a 15-20 minute long encounter with a young wolf, where you can pose for pictures, pet, and play!
Then if you’re really a wolf-lover at heart and want to go all out, try the Ultimate Wolf Experience—featuring one to two hours of time with various wolves and their trainers in a controlled environment.
